PHP unserialize تحافظ على إلقاء نفس الخطأ أكثر من 100 مرة جزء 2

StackOverflow https://stackoverflow.com/questions/122216

  •  02-07-2019
  •  | 
  •  

سؤال

لذلك يجب كبيرة 2d array أنني تسلسل ، ولكن عند محاولة unserialize مجموعة ويلقي فقط نفس الخطأ إلى نقطة ما يقرب من تحطمها فايرفوكس.

الخطأ هو:

Warning: unserialize() [function.unserialize]: Node no longer exists in /var/www/dev/wc_paul/inc/analyzerTester.php on line 24

وأود أن تشمل كامل تسلسل مجموعة أنني صدى ولكن آخر مرة حاولت أن على هذا الشكل الذي تحطمت بلادي فايرفوكس.

لا أحد لديه أي فكرة لماذا هذا قد يكون يحدث ؟

أنا متأكد من أن هذا هو صفيف.إلا أنه كان في الأصل XML استجابة من خادم آخر ثم سحبت من القيم لبناء مجموعة.إذا لا يمكن أن يكون تسلسل أنا لا يمكن أن يقبل أن أعتقد...ولكن كيف ينبغي أن تذهب عن حفظ ذلك ؟

هل كانت مفيدة؟

المحلول

عادة, عندما تحصل على رسالة خطأ ، يمكنك معرفة الكثير ببساطة عن طريق البحث في الإنترنت عن تلك الرسالة.على سبيل المثال, عندما كنت وضعت العقدة لم يعد موجودا في جوجل, يمكنك في نهاية المطاف مع موجز تفسير لماذا يحدث هذا ، جنبا إلى جنب مع الحل, أول ضربة.

نصائح أخرى

للإجابة على السؤال الثاني حول كيف يمكن حفظ البيانات

لماذا لا إخراج xml التجاوب مباشرة إلى ملف وحفظه محليا ، ثم قراءة من الملفات المحلية عند الاقتضاء.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top